Our members in SERS who are eligible for retirement may want to start thinking now about what 2022 will mean to them; members in TRS are not affected by the pension changes, but will be affected by the fairly minor retiree healthcare changes: Pension By far the biggest change is the loss of the 2% minimum cost of living adjustment. If that amount is under 2% - recently, it has been more often than not the retiree still receives a 2% raise. For anyone retiring after July 1, 2022 that will no longer be true; if the CPI-W rises, for example, 0.4%, the COLA will be 0.4%. The new COLA system for those retiring July 1, 2022 or later is tied to the Consumer Price Index and also features a series of caps that could produce adjustments smaller than the CPI.
